3. Methods
◦ Some methods explained in this Articles are of the author explaining the use of
studies.
◦ The author in this article made the use of surveying in particular Latina Women. For
example stated in the article were 30 surveys and 4 interviews.
◦ Age span was from 29-62 and 1-26 years of teaching experience.
4. Barriers
◦ Some barriers noted in this study were:
◦ Latinas feared that we would 1) be discriminated by race during screening, interviews,
and or selection.
◦ 2) That we would be viewed at negatively by colleagues due to the low number of
Latinas on board.
◦ 3) Finally that the community would have a preference of a white person for
administrative positions.
